Compaction on Birchline MQ is falling behind on the orders topic; segments pile up and restarts take minutes. This change tightens the compactor schedule and caps dirty ratio per partition. On-call: if lag alarms fire post-merge, revert the scheduler commit only, not the whole PR. New settings are listed below.

tuning constants:
QUOTAS = {
    "druwyn": 5,
    "holix": 5,
    "zorath": 5,
    "holwyn": 10,
}

## Deployment — StageGrid Seat-Map Renderer

Build with `make bundle`, push to the Fennworth artifact store, then roll the renderer pods one at a time. Venue layouts cache for 15 minutes; flush the cache after any hall-geometry change or support will see stale seat maps. Do not hot-edit pods — drift here breaks box-office parity. The deployment config the service expects is listed below.

service settings:
PRAIX_LOG_LEVEL=error
PRAIX_METRICS_HOST=metrics.praix.qorvelcorp.corp
PRAIX_POOL_SIZE=16

## Authentication

The Fernhollow deep-link router validates every mobile link against the internal route-registry service before redirecting, which prevents spoofed app-open URLs. If you are paged for deep-link failures, first confirm the router can authenticate; expired credentials are the most common cause of blanket 403s. Tokens are scoped read-only and rotate monthly. To run the diagnostic script against the route registry from the bastion host, use the key below.

gateway credential: kto3_qfe

# Pickpath Optimizer — plugin environment
# Plugin authors: this file configures your local Pickpath sandbox.
# PICKPATH_WAREHOUSE_LAYOUT points at the sample floor map; PICKPATH_BATCH_SIZE
# controls pick-list grouping. Plugins that call the routing API must
# authenticate. Add the routing API secret on the line directly below
# this comment block.

secret setting of tawif-tajop: COURIER_KEY13=819c65d82d2bd

The aggregation step now normalizes units before summing, and a regression test covers mixed-unit fleets. Historical reports generated between 2.3.0 and 2.4.0 may be inflated; a backfill script lives in tools/refuel-backfill and should be run once per affected fleet. Future maintainers: do not modify the normalization layer without consulting the report's designated owner, identified below.

named custodian: Belius Casath Ulaix Sorius